Description

  • Zao Wou-Ki (Zhao Wuji)
  • A: Nocturne; B: Vol d'oiseaux (Flying birds) [Two Works]
  • lithograph
A: signed in Pinyin and Chinese, dated 55 and numbered 92/150
executed in 1955, this work is number 92 from an edition of 150.
B: signed in Pinyin and Chinese, dated 54 and numbered 48/95
executed in 1954, this work is number 48 from an edition of 95.

Provenance

Private European Collection

Exhibited

Taipei, Printmakers Art Gallery, Zao Wou-Ki, 1980 (B)
Paris, Bibliothèque Nationale de France, Zao Wou-Ki: Estampes et livres illustrés, June 3 - August 24, 2008 (B)
Udine, Go Art Gallery, Zao Wou-Ki 1950 – 2010: 60 Years of Graphic Works, March 3 - 30, 2012 (A & B)
Luxembourg, Galerie F. Hessler, Hommage À Zao Wou-Ki 1920 - 2013, May 18 - July 20, 2013 (B)

Literature

Nesto Jacometti, ed., Catalogue raisonné de l'oeuvre gravée et lithographiée de Zao Wou-Ki, 1949 – 1954, Edition Gutenkunst & Klipstein, Bern, 1955, plate 65, p. 77 (A); plate 61, p. 73 (B)
Yves Rivière, ed., Zao Wou-Ki Les estampes 1937 - 1974, Arts et Métiers Graphiques, Paris, 1975, plate 96, p. 59 (A); plate 91, p. 56 (B)
Yuan Dexing, ed., Zao Wou-Ki, Yuancheng Publishing Limited, Taipei, 1980, p. 20 (B)
Jørgen Ågerup, ed., Zao Wou-Ki: The Graphic Work, A Catalogue Raisonné 1937 - 1995, Edition Heede & Moestrup, Copenhagen, 1995, plate 93, p. 64 (A); plate 88, p. 62 (B), illustrated in colour
Céline Chicha, Marie Minssieux-Chamonard, Hélène Trespeuch, ed., Zao Wou-Ki: Estampes et livres illustrés, Bibliothèque Nationale de France, Paris, 2008, plate 18, illustrated in colour (B)
Zao Wou-Ki 1950 - 2010: 60 Years of Graphic Works, Go Art Gallery, Udine, 2012, p. 14 (A); p. 12 (B), illustrated in colour
Hommage À Zao Wou-Ki 1920 - 2013, Galerie F. Hessler, Luxembourg, 2013, p. 8, illustrated in colour (B)
